Mapping Rural Pakistan

Khwarizmi Science Society and Government M.A.O. College bring together a Public Lecture on mapping rural Pakistan. Dr. Sohaib Khan's work demonstrates the employment of modern georeferencing tools for registering British-era Mauza maps of Pakistan. The work promises to revolutionize geographical distribution of resources inside the country and will help identify sensitive areas in relation to poverty, illiteracy, crime, natural disasters and other socio-economic indicators.
